本书作者皮诺是一个非常聪明和雄心勃勃的专业人员。他曾就读于麻省理工学院,并获得富布赖特奖学金在伦敦经济学院从事研究工作。皮诺的智力和魅力也使他能在咨询业一些最著名的公司、包括波士顿咨询集团度过十几年。由于本书的出版,他现在能给其简历增添一个新的头衔:告密者。 本书是他的忏悔,也是他作为咨询顾问的苦恼而不满的人生的日志。他所描述的冒险经历无论对他自己还是对咨询业来说都并不令人喜欢。他的表现像是一个自私的乳臭小儿,一个没有目的的漂泊者,至多只能对短暂的私人或职业关系承担义务。
